What they do
A Supply Chain Analyst analyzes data to identify inefficiencies and potential improvements in the supply chain system for a company or organization. Analyzes workflow and costs associated with procurement, production, and distribution; analyzes sales and customer demand data; completes cost benefit analysis for proposed changes in production processes.

Position This is an exciting opportunity for an accomplished supply chain leader to join Digi International's Opengear Operations team in Sandy, Utah. This is a hybrid role located in Sandy, UT. What We Offer As our Supply Chain Manager, you will own end-to-end material planning, inventory strategy, freight and logistics optimization, and supplier performance for our light manufacturing facility — driving measurable results against real business priorities like inventory reduction, freight cost savings, and on-time delivery. You will independently determine objectives, lead cross-functional initiatives, and directly influence the long-range direction of our supply chain. If you are a proven supply chain leader who thrives on ownership and impact — join us. What You Will Do Inventory Strategy & Working Capital Own inventory reduction strategy — reduce gross inventory through disciplined safety stock reviews, lead time management, and PO push-out/pull-in execution based on changing demand. Drive inventory turns improvement (target: 3.2 4+) by reviewing order quantities and ensuring consumption horizons stay within 6 months. Manage component-level inventory reduction initiatives; direct contract manufacturers (CMs) to consume available Opengear-owned excess material before purchasing new components. Oversee consignment inventory strategy across the Sandy facility and CM locations, including excess material management. Freight, Logistics & Cost Optimization Lead freight cost reduction strategy, shifting PO planning toward ocean freight (DHL, FedEx, Mainfreight, Quality SVC, Expeditors) wherever operationally feasible. Develop and execute tariff avoidance strategy leveraging USMCA and alternative sourcing to minimize tariff expense. Drive strategic sourcing and PPV (purchase price variance) savings initiatives across key commodities (e.g., memory, semiconductor components) through supplier negotiations and buydown programs. Identify and execute project-level cost savings opportunities, including manufacturing footprint and box-build sourcing strategies with external partners. Customer Delivery & NPI Collaboration Own on-time delivery (OTD) performance through disciplined PO management using SourceDay or equivalent supplier collaboration platforms. Align contract manufacturer delivery commitments with customer requirements; proactively resolve delivery date conflicts. Partner with Engineering on New Product Introduction (NPI) readiness, ensuring component and supply chain survey results translate into on-time supply chain execution. Monitor and report supply chain performance metrics to leadership, highlighting risks and improvement opportunities. Material Planning & Supplier Management Lead material requirements planning (MRP) to ensure materials are available to support the master production schedule; proactively identify and resolve supply risks before they impact production. Manage supplier and subcontractor relationships domestically and internationally; negotiate pricing, lead times, and delivery commitments. Support export compliance activities including trade agreements, customs documentation, and import/export coordination. Maintain data integrity within ERP systems (Epicor or equivalent) for planning, inventory, and purchasing. Data Analysis & Reporting Extract and manipulate data from the ERP system using Business Activity Queries (BAQs) to support inventory, purchasing, and supply chain reporting. Use Excel (including Power Query) to build, automate, and maintain recurring supply chain reports and dashboards. Translate raw ERP data into actionable insights for inventory turns, freight costs, PPV, and OTD performance tracking.
